CUJO Smart Firewall mdnscap mDNS record parsing code execution vulnerability
Summary An exploitable double free vulnerability exists in the mdnscap binary of the CUJO Smart Firewall. When parsing mDNS packets, a memory space is freed twice if an invalid query name is encountered, leading to arbitrary code execution in the context of the mdnscap process. An unauthenticated...

CVE-2017-17428
CVE-2017-17428 is a Bleichenbacher-style RSA padding oracle (ROBOT) vulnerability that can allow an attacker to decrypt TLS data by exploiting RSA PKCS#1.
